What Is Jeep Death Wobble?
Death wobble is a strong vibration in the front steering and suspension. It may begin after the front tires hit a bump, pothole, or uneven road surface at certain speeds. The steering wheel shakes until the vehicle speed drops.
This condition does not come from one single part. Small amounts of wear across several steering and suspension components may work together and create the problem. A trained technician checks the complete steering system before recommending repairs.

Why Does Professional Diagnosis Matter?
Death wobble develops from movement somewhere within the steering or suspension system. Finding every source requires proper tools, experience, and careful testing.
Professional inspections include checking:
- Track bar
- Ball joints
- Tie rod ends
- Drag link
- Wheel bearings
- Control arm bushings
- Steering linkage
- Suspension hardware
- Wheel alignment
- Tire balance
Each part plays an important role in steering stability. A complete inspection helps create a lasting Jeep death wobble fix instead of replacing parts through trial and error.
